Thea Render is a versatile 3D rendering engine that integrates seamlessly with SketchUp, providing both unbiased and interactive render modes directly within the SketchUp interface. This integration allows users to enrich their models with highly detailed content without limitations, facilitating the creation of stunning, photorealistic images.
Key Features:
- Interactive Rendering: Thea for SketchUp enables interactive rendering either within the Thea window or directly inside the SketchUp viewport. This feature offers immediate feedback with production-quality results, enhancing the design workflow
- Advanced Material Editor: The integrated material editor brings all the advanced features of Thea materials into SketchUp, allowing for detailed and precise material customization.
- AI Denoising: Thea supports both NVIDIA and Intel AI denoisers, offering GPU and CPU accelerated denoising for both interactive and production renderings. This dramatically reduces render times while producing high-quality, noise-free images
- Adaptive Tracing: This technique addresses challenging lighting scenarios, such as caustics from point lights and diffuse interreflections, resulting in images with a higher dynamic range and lighting effects that were previously difficult to achieve.
- Relight Editor: The Relight feature allows users to modify the intensity, color, and status of every light in the scene after rendering, enabling the creation of multiple lighting setups from a single render.
Thea for SketchUp is compatible with both Windows and macOS platforms. For activation, users can lease a license by navigating to Extensions > Thea Render > License Setup within SketchUp, entering their Altair One email and password, and clicking ‘Activate’.
Educational licenses require loading a license file (.dat) in the Educational tab of the License Setup window.
